DEV Community

Helena Chandler
Helena Chandler

Posted on

A Deep Dive into WingRiders' Agent-Based Escrow Model

This technical guide explores how to use WingRiders, the leading WingRiders Cardano DEX, with a specific focus on its unique WingRiders Agents Model and the role of WingRiders Escrow contracts.

Step 1: The Problem with Direct Smart Contract Interaction

On many AMMs, when a user submits a trade, their UTxOs are sent directly to the main smart contract pool. This can create contention and unpredictable execution times, especially on an eUTxO blockchain like Cardano.

Step 2: The WingRiders Agent Solution

WingRiders introduces an intermediary layer of "Agents."

How it Works: When you submit a trade, your funds are sent to a unique, one-time-use escrow contract controlled by a WingRiders Agent. This Agent is responsible for batching your transaction with others and then interacting with the main liquidity pool.

The Benefit: This model significantly reduces contention on the main smart contract, leading to faster, more reliable execution. It's a core component of the WingRiders security and performance architecture.

Step 3: From the User's Perspective

Navigate to the WingRiders DEX Official platform.

Connect your Cardano wallet.

When you execute a swap or provide liquidity for WingRiders yield farming, you are signing a transaction that interacts with one of these temporary escrow contracts.

The Agent handles the rest.

This elegant solution abstracts away the complexities of the eUTxO model, providing a smoother user experience. For a full architectural diagram, see the Full Official Documentation.

Top comments (0)